Having said that, a lot of what is understood with regards to the anatomy and physiology of pain is from scientific tests of experimentally induced cutaneous (skin) pain, when most clinical pain arises from deep tissues. Hence, although experimental research provide rather very good designs for acute pain, They are really weak types for scientific syndromes of Persistent pain. Don't just do they offer little information about the muscles, joints, and tendons which are most often influenced by chronically painful situations, but they do not address the wide assortment of psychosocial aspects that impact the pain knowledge profoundly. To further improve our understanding and remedy of pain we will need greater animal versions of human pain and greater instruments for learning clinical pain.
